Job Summary

We are seeking a skilled Patient Care Technician to join our team at LifePoint Health. As a Patient Care Technician, you will play a vital role in providing high-quality patient care and support to our patients and their families.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form Basic Patient Care Activities: Monitor vital signs, take blood glucose measurements, and record intake and output as delegated and supervised by an RN.
  • Assist with Personal Care and Activities of Daily Living: Help patients with bathing, grooming, eating, and ambulation, ensuring their comfort and dignity.
  • Maintain a Clean and Organized Environment: Assist with keeping patient rooms and common areas stocked, clean, and orderly, promoting a safe and healthy environment for patients and staff.
